In order to avoid these conflicts, you need to put jQuery in no-conflict mode immediately after it is loaded onto the page and before you attempt to use jQuery in your page.
<script type="text/javascript" src="jquery.js"></script>
<script type="text/javascript">
$.noConflict();
// Code that uses other library's $ can follow here.
</script>

If you don't want to define another alternative to the full jQuery function name, then there's still another approach you might try:
Simply add the $ as an argument passed to your jQuery( document ).ready() function. This is most frequently used in the case where you still want the benefits of really concise jQuery code, but don't want to cause conflicts with other libraries.
<script type="text/javascript" src="jquery.js"></script>
<script type="text/javascript">
$.noConflict();
jQuery(document).ready(function($) {
// Code that uses jQuery's $ can follow here.
});
// Code that uses other library's $ can follow here.
</script>
If you include jQuery before other libraries, you may use jQuery when you do some work with jQuery, but the $ will have the meaning defined in the other library. There is no need to relinquish the $ alias by calling jQuery.noConflict().
<script src="jquery.js"></script>
<script src="prototype.js"></script<
<script>
// Use full jQuery function name to reference jQuery.
jQuery( document ).ready(function() {
jQuery( "div" ).hide();
});
// Use the $ variable as defined in prototype.js
window.onload = function() {
var mainDiv = $( "main" );
};
</script>
